Card Information
- Pokemon
- Blaine's Ponyta
- Number
- #64 / 132
- Set
- Gym Challenge
- Rarity
- Common
- HP
- 50
- Type
- Fire
- Stage
- Basic
- Illustrator
- Ken Sugimori
- Weakness
- Water ×2
Hind Kick
20If you have any Benched Pokémon, flip a coin. If heads, switch Blaine's Ponyta with 1 of your Benched Pokémon.
